      <study_design>Randomization: Randomized, Blinding: Not blinded, Placebo: Not used, Assignment: Parallel, Purpose: Treatment, Randomization description: The first step is to create a random sequence number. For this purpose, we will use a random number generator on Stattrek (https://stattrek.com/statistics/random-number-generator.aspx) for 50 numbers ranging from 1 to 2 (for example 2 1  1 2 1 2 1 1 2 2  2  1 1 2 2 1 2 2..............).Then, we will specify the numbers to the groups, for example, 1 will be assigned to the intervention group, and the numbers 2 to the control group. Each number will represent a group according to the defined numbers. With this method, we will have a specific sequence of 50 codes of  1, 2, which shows the first to 50th people who are going to be entered into the study in each group. We write the codes on a piece of paper and put them in an envelope to use during sampling. Thus, after reviewing the inclusion criteria and if the participants desire, we will enter each person included in the study according to our predetermined list.</study_design>

      <i_freetext>Intervention 1: Intervention group :After calculating the amount of calories needed by each person using the Meflin formula, each person  For 12 weeks, receiving the co-administration of DASH and intermittent fasting 16:8 diets . 16 hours of a day  in intermittent fasting for example, from 8:00 PM to 12:00 noon the next day and 8 hours of receiving  the DASH diet ,which includes the consumption of whole grains, 2 to 3 units of low-fat or fat-free dairy products, 7 to 8 units of fruits and vegetables,  limiting saturated fats and sweets and sugar-sweetened drinks. Intervention 2: Control group: They receive nutritional recommendations to control the disease: Avoid consuming too much sugar,  jam, honey, syrup, soft drinks, and other foods that contain sugar. These foods aggravate fatty liver. It should be noted that the consumption of alcoholic beverages can cause and aggravate the symptoms of fatty liver. Be sure to use different vegetables with meals.</i_freetext>
